Monday.com is a work management platform allowing for increased collaboration and visibility across an organization. Delivered via a SaaS-based model, users can track progress across marketing and development initiatives, create and automate workflows, and manage IT approvals. Revenue is generated on a per-seat basis across several pricing tiers. As of fiscal 2024, the company had over 245,000 customers.
Knight-Swift is the largest full-truckload carrier in the US, with a diversified transportation offering. Pro forma for the US Xpress deal, about 82% of revenue derives from Knight's asset-based trucking business, with full truckload (for-hire dry van, refrigerated, and dedicated contract) making up 69% and less than truckload 13%. Truck brokerage and other asset-light logistics services make up 9% of revenue, with intermodal near 6%. Knight's intermodal operations use the Class I railroads for the underlying movement of its shipping containers and include drayage (regional trucking services to and from inland intermodal ramps/terminals). The remainder of revenue reflects services offered to shippers and third-party truckers, including equipment maintenance and leasing.
